Dental Assistant Salary in Leavenworth, KS
How much does a Dental Assistant make in Leavenworth, KS?
In Leavenworth, KS, a Dental Assistant earns a competitive salary. On average, Dental Assistants make around $43,661 per year. This figure can vary based on experience and specific skills. Those new to the field might start at the lower end of the salary range, while experienced professionals can earn more.
The salary range for Dental Assistants in Leavenworth, KS, spans from $32,000 to $57,647 annually. This range reflects the different levels of expertise and responsibilities within the role. Factors such as additional certifications, specialized training, and years of experience can influence where one falls within this range. Job seekers can expect to see growth in their earnings as they gain more experience and skills in the field.
